How deep does a geothermal heat pump go?

It requires trenches at least four feet deep. The most common layouts either use two pipes, one buried at six feet, and the other at four feet, or two pipes placed side-by-side at five feet in the ground in a two-foot wide trench.

How deep is a typical geothermal well?

Geothermal Wells are typically anywhere from 150 feet deep to 400 feet deep. Some drilling companies have equipment that can drill wells deeper than 600 feet, but they are not typical.

How far does a heat pump go into the ground?

The number and depth of boreholes will be dictated by the size of the heat pump and the geology. These will be anything from 70m to 120m deep. As the temperature of the ground rises with depth it is often advantageous to have fewer, deeper boreholes, but that is not always possible.

How deep is deep geothermal?

Long experience with deep geothermal energy (depth: 800–3000 metres)

How much electricity does a geothermal heat pump use?

Efficiency. That’s why it takes only one kilowatt-hour of electricity for a geothermal heat pump to produce nearly 12,000 Btu of cooling or heating. (To produce the same number of Btus, a standard heat pump on a 95-degree day consumes 2.2 kilowatt-hours.)

How warm does geothermal heating get?

Geothermal heat pumps, meanwhile, take heat from the Earth’s constant ground temperature (45° to 75℉ depending on your location) to heat your home. High-efficiency geothermal systems tend to operate between 100 to 120℉. Your traditional HVAC system is designed to operate at 180 to 200℉.

Does a heat pump have to be on an outside wall?

Heat pumps are easiest to install on an external wall. It is sometimes possible to install them on an internal wall (a wall dividing 2 rooms), although it is usually a more involved and costly process.

Is geothermal energy clean?

Geothermal energy is heat derived below the earth’s surface which can be harnessed to generate clean, renewable energy. This vital, clean energy resource supplies renewable power around the clock and emits little or no greenhouse gases — all while requiring a small environmental footprint to develop.

How do you make geothermal energy?

Geothermal Power Plants

Hot water is pumped from deep underground through a well under high pressure. When the water reaches the surface, the pressure is dropped, which causes the water to turn into steam. The steam spins a turbine, which is connected to a generator that produces electricity.

How deep is a ground source heat pump?

1. Drilling a ground source heat pump borehole. A borehole consists of a hole drilled between 60 to 200m deep. Typically, the diameter of a borehole is around 110 to 150mm, but this depends on the type of machine being used to drill the borehole.

Do heat pumps work in older houses?

Air source heat pumps can be suitable for older properties as a well as new, but more thought will need to be given to the internal heating system and the insulation levels of the house to ensure that a heat pump installation remains cost-effective, and worth it.

Which side of house is best for heat pump?

The outdoor heat pump component usually weighs 120 pounds or so and should always be placed in a shady location that is outside of direct sunlight. Keep it directly on the side of or behind the home, and don’t place it too close to any shrubbery or vegetation (this can easily create airflow problems).

How many years should a heat pump last?

Heat pumps normally last an average of 15 years, though some can wear out after a decade. Some of the newer units being manufactured today can last a bit longer. The factor most important in determining the lifespan of your heat pump is maintenance.

How long does it take to put in a heat pump?

A simple back to back installation can be done in as little as 3 hours, but generally takes around 5 hours. More complex systems can take up to a day (or possibly longer) depending on the complexity of the system.

How does dry steam power plant work?

Dry Steam Power Plant

Dry steam plants use hydrothermal fluids that are primarily steam. The steam travels directly to a turbine, which drives a generator that produces electricity. The steam eliminates the need to burn fossil fuels to run the turbine (also eliminating the need to transport and store fuels).

How does a geothermal heat pump work?

For heating, a geothermal heat pump removes the heat from the fluid in the earth connection, concentrates it, and then transfers it to the building. For cooling, the process is reversed. Conventional ductwork is generally used to distribute heated or cooled air from the geothermal heat pump throughout the building.
